On January 16th, 2025, we received another EB-2 NIW (National Interest Waiver) approval for a Researcher in the Field of Epidemiology (Approval Notice).
General Field: Epidemiology
Position at the Time of Case Filing: Researcher
Country of Origin: China
State of Residence at the Time of Filing: California
Approval Notice Date: January 16th, 2025
Processing Time: 1 month, 11 days (Premium Processing Requested)
Case Summary:
A researcher has sought our assistance with his NIW (National Interest Waiver) application. His research revolves around utilizing large population-level data to identify the biological, genetic, and social risk factors for cancers to reduce the frequency and severity of cancer diagnoses, an area of research of clear substantial merit and national importance.
After reviewing our client’s credentials in epidemiology, we determined that he met the regulatory criteria, with the evidence collectively demonstrating his national and international acclaim to the top of his field. Motivated to support his application, we prepared a compelling case tailored to his background and achievements, highlighting the following details:
- Our client has substantial academic accomplishments, holding an M.S. in epidemiology and contributing to 9 peer-reviewed journal articles (5 of them first-authored) and 4 conference abstracts (2 of them first-authored). These papers have been published in at least 3 highly ranked peer-reviewed journals.
- His publications have been highly influential, receiving over 155 citations, which have earned him significant recognition and credibility among peers in his field.
- Additionally, our client has conducted 66 peer reviews to date, further establishing his expertise and authority in the field.
